Big Salt White Blend Pinot Noir mint and violet combine with50% Riesling, 30% Gewurztraminer, 14% Early Muscat, 3% Sauvignon Blanc, and 3% others sourced from 10 vineyards throughout Oregon soils. As production ramps up, quality remains consistently high in this proprietary blend of co fermented Muscat, Riesling and Gewurztraminer.
